Placement papers | Freshers Walkin | Jobs daily: Software Engineer In Test at AffiniPay (Austin, TX)


Search jobs and placement papers

Software Engineer In Test at AffiniPay (Austin, TX)

Software Engineer in Test  

Development

AffiniPay is looking for a Quality Engineer that is passionate about building great automation systems and delivering high quality code into production. Our ideal candidate will have strong experience with building automated test suites and running continuous integration systems for web-based applications and APIs. You will also be responsible for developing QA procedures, testing of software and reporting on the quality of the current builds. This role will expose you to all aspects of the software stack and will expose you to many cutting edge frameworks/tools. This is an exciting opportunity for someone to join a growing company as part of a fast-paced, agile engineering team.

Responsibilities:

  • Define test strategy, create test plans and test cases
  • Design, develop, and deploy advanced automated testing frameworks that provide reliable and repeatable test results
  • Develop internal QA tools to effectively test components/applications
  • Perform testing of features and bugs at all levels of the stack
  • Build and maintain QA infrastructure to provide a reliable build pipeline and test environments
  • Analyze and decompose complex issues and collaborate with others to drive adoption of best practices in code health, testing, and maintainability


Requirements:

  • BS in computer science or equivalent related work experience
  • 3+ years in a QA or development role
  • Experience with one or more general purpose programming languages including but not limited to: Ruby, Python, JavaScript, or Java, and able to write automated tests, scripts, and tools
  • Experience in design/development of an automation framework
  • Experience with REST APIs and other back-end systems
  • Experience with Travis, Jenkins, or some other CI system
  • Familiar with Linux shell
  • Experience with Git or other SCM
  • Familiarity with SQL, databases, and data-driven automated tests
  • Strong understanding of concepts related to computer architecture, data structures and programming practices
  • Natural inclination of staying ahead to learn current trends and best practices in software test automation
  • Ability to thrive in a fast-paced, agile team environment
  • Ability to work effectively, efficiently and independently with minimal oversight

Nice to Have:

  • Working knowledge of building and administering CI/CD systems
  • Extensive knowledge of Unix/Linux environments
  • Deep knowledge of Internet technologies
  • Experience with performance testing or security testing
  • Experience developing simple test tools or test harnesses to aid in testing
  • Experience using cloud-computing services such as AWS or Google Cloud Platform
  • Experience with IaC, Terraform, etc.
  • Experience with payment certifications such as PCI

AffiniPay is proud to be an Equal Opportunity Employer.


by via developer jobs - Stack Overflow
 

No comments:

Post a Comment